¿Unir archivos CSV no espaciales a datos espaciales (shapefile) usando QGIS?

37

Tengo un archivo CSV que tiene datos de código postal en un campo, pero no es espacial, por ejemplo. no este y el norte.

Tengo un shapefile con código postal en un campo y algunos datos adicionales.

Quiero unirme al CSV con el shapefile basado en atributos (campos de código postal). Sé que puedo hacer esto en ArcMap, pero ¿cómo puedo lograr lo mismo en QGIS?

    
pregunta gisuser 22.02.2011 - 15:58

4 respuestas

27

Una forma rápida es usar el complemento mmqgis que unirá su archivo csv al shapefile por campos de código postal

    
respondido por el Mapperz 22.02.2011 - 16:16
33

La próxima versión de QGIS versión 1.7 tendrá una función de unión integrada en las propiedades de la capa. La velocidad de las uniones también es bastante impresionante.

Pasos para unirse:

  1. Abra csv a través del icono de vector abierto.
  2. Abra la pestaña de propiedades en la capa a la que desea unirse (su mapa)
  3. Haz clic en la pestaña Unirse y presiona el botón +
  4. Seleccione la capa csv y las dos columnas a las que desea unirse.
  5. Pulsa Aceptar en el cuadro de diálogo de propiedades.

    
respondido por el Nathan W 01.06.2011 - 01:29
0

Si carga sus datos en MS Access, ftools le permitirá unirse a una tabla de MS Access.

Inicia el instalador del complemento qgis, habilita los repositorios de terceros y las herramientas estarán disponibles.

luego use la herramienta de complementos yendo a fTools > Herramientas de gestión de datos > Unir atributos

    
respondido por el relima 22.02.2011 - 16:12
0

El complemento fTools para trabajar con datos vectoriales también te dará la misma opción para "unir datos en un atributo" incluso si no es espacial.

    
respondido por el Archaeogeek 22.02.2011 - 17:45

Lea otras preguntas en las etiquetas